Özet (EN)
This study was carried out in order to determine risk factors related to obesity and diet in breast cancer occurrence with 40 patients aged 18 and over, who were recently diagnosed with breast cancer and who applied to Hacettepe University Faculty of Medicine Oncology Hospital Medical Oncology Unit (case group), and 40 volunteer individuals with no diagnosis of cancer and no cancer history in the family, who had similar characteristics to the patient group (PG) with respect to age and who applied to Hacettepe University Department of Internal Medicine (control group). A questionnaire form developed for the study was applied on all the individuals taken into the scope of the study by the researcher through face-to-face interview method. The body compositions of all the individuals were measured using bioelectrical impedance analysis (BIA). The measurements of body weights, heights, waist circumference, hip circumference were taken by the researcher. The body mass index (BMI) values were calculated using the heights and weights. Average amounts of daily energy and nutritional element consumption through diet was identified using the food consumption frequency form. Certain biochemical parameters were analyzed and the status of physical activity was assessed. In this study, the mean age of individuals with breast cancer was found 51.8±12.90 years and that of the control group (CG) was found 50.9±13.05 years. It was determined that 22.5% of the individuals with breast cancer had cancer history in their families. The mean menarcheal age of the individuals with breast cancer was determined as 13.03±1.17 years, while it was found to be 12.3±0.95 years in individuals from the control group [OR: 1.835 (95% CI= 1.102 - 3.055), p=0.020]. The mean age at first birth was determined as 22.64±3.78 years in individuals with breast cancer, and 21.63±2.99 years in the control group [OR: 1.195 (95% CI= 11.003 - 1.424), p=0.046]. The median of the number of children, on the other hand, was found 2 (1 - 6) in individuals with breast cancer and 2 (1 - 3) in the control group [OR: 2.488 (95% CI= 0.886 - 6.990)]. It was established that individuals who smoked had 1.762 times higher risk for developing breast cancer [OR: 1.762 (95% CI= 1.036 - 2.997)]. As for individuals who drank alcohol, the risk of breast cancer was 1.342 times higher, yet this amount of risk was not found to be statistically significant (p>0.05). No statistically significant relation was detected between BMI and breast cancer (p>0.05). It was found out that 47.5% of the individuals with breast cancer and 30.0% of the ones in the CG ate quickly. It was determined that breast cancer risk was 3.562 times higher in individuals eating quickly than those who eat slowly [OR: 3.562 (95% CI= 1.183 - 10.731)]. It was established that 40% of the individuals in PG and 52.5% of those in CG consumed two snacks a day. No statistically significant difference was found between PG and CG in terms of the number of snacks (p >0.05). When the types of oil generally used in meals are examined, sunflower seed oil was the oil type that was preferred the most for both groups in meat dishes (PG: 45.0%, CG: 62.5%), pastries (PG: 55.0%, CG: 72.5%) and fried foods (PG: 77.5%, CG: 80.0%). As for cooking methods, it was established that 77.5% of the women in PG used oven/grill/pan and 75.0% of them used frying in oil when cooking meat, while 87.5% of those in CG used oven/grill/pan and 67.5% used boiling. When cooking fish, on the other hand, 80.0% of the women in PG used frying in oil while 82.5% of those in CG preferred oven/grill/pan. The difference between the amounts of cholesterol intake of individuals in PG and those in CG was regarded statistically significant (p<0.05). It was determined that daily average pulp intake of the individuals in PG was 19.4±5.24 g, whereas that of the individuals in CG was 27.2±6.86 g [OR: 0.813 (95% CI: 0.738 - 0.897)] and this difference between the groups was determined to be statistically significant (p<0.05). It was also determined that the risk of developing breast cancer in individuals who consumed garlic [OR: 3.5 (95% CI= 0.768 - 15.598, p=0.008)] and fresh vegetables [(OR: 5.83 (95% CI= 1.470 - 23.155, p=0.019) two or three times a day was 3.5 and 5.83 times higher, respectively, than those who consumed them every day. In conclusion, it can be stated that there is a relation between breast cancer and lifestyle factors and that the risk of developing breast cancer can be reduced with changes to be made in the diet, one of the lifestyle factors.
